Common Digital Marketing Problems We See In Abington
Most businesses don’t struggle because they “did nothing.” They struggle because things were done halfway or without a clear strategy.
Here’s what we typically see when working with Abington area businesses:
- A website that looks fine but generates almost no leads
- An inconsistent or abandoned social media presence
- Google Ads campaigns running without proper conversion tracking
- A Google Business Profile that’s outdated or under-optimized
- No clear picture of where leads are actually coming from

Frequently Asked Questions About Digital Marketing in Abington
How can digital marketing help my business in Abington?
Digital marketing helps you get in front of people right when they’re looking for your services. Whether someone’s searching on Google, scrolling social media, or asking an AI tool for recommendations, the goal is to make sure your business shows up and stands out. Done right, it brings in consistent leads without relying only on word-of-mouth.
What digital marketing services are most useful for businesses in Abington?
Most businesses in Abington see strong results from a mix of local SEO, Google Ads, and a well-built website. Social media can help too, depending on your audience. The key is choosing the channels where your customers are already spending time and making sure everything works together.
Is digital marketing competitive in Abington?
It’s growing more competitive, but it’s still very manageable. Some businesses are investing heavily, while others haven’t done much yet. That creates a good opportunity—if you have a clear strategy and stay consistent, you can stand out pretty quickly.
How are people in Abington finding businesses online today?
Most people still start with Google, but more are also using AI-powered search tools to get quick answers and recommendations. They’ll usually compare a few businesses, check reviews, and visit websites before reaching out. So it’s important to show up, look credible, and make it easy for them to contact you.
What should I focus on first with digital marketing in Abington?
Start with the basics: a solid website, an optimized Google Business Profile, and a way to track leads. From there, you can layer in SEO, ads, or content depending on your goals. It doesn’t have to be complicated—just focused and consistent.
